      I don't necessarily need a higher flow rate than what the Taprite does, but it would be nice if I can get it in the approximate price range I'm looking at. It would be nice to shave some time off keg cleaning cycles, tanks purges, etc.

      I've been looking at Micromatic, which charges $250 for a 4 pressure rig a with 3.5 max scfm capacity, and UltraFlow, which charges $165 for 4 pressure rig with a 9 max scfm capacity, so there's certainly plenty of variance within the >$300 price range.

      The Kegco ones I linked to, however, were absolutely too low flow to perform brewery tasks. It'd be great if more vendors listed the flow capacity up front, but alas.

          I've used many different regulators and the old adage "you get what you pay for" certainly applies. These cheaper brands are full of plastic parts that just don't last long. My go-to now is Cornelius, but Micromatic and Perlick are both good. If you are looking for instantaneous, or short bursts of low-pressure CO2 in your process (as for cleaning kegs), then I suggest a different strategy: Don't buy a regulator with high flow capabilities for short bursts; use an accumulation tank. This tank fills "slowly" between cycles, but is available for high-flow, short-duration bursts of gas. You'd place this as close to the keg washer as possible so you don't have much pipe losses. Works great where I've used it. Works well with air too. It also increases total system air capacity so that your compressor cycles a bit less. Be sure to have safety relief valve on it.
